浅析脱硫旁路挡板铅封实施后联锁保护逻辑的完善

摘    要:根据国家环境保护部办公厅文件要求,需要对火电企业脱硫旁路挡板实施铅封。石灰石一石膏湿法脱硫工艺具有脱硫效果好、技术成熟等优点,在目前国内的燃煤发电机组中广为应用。旁路挡板作为连接主机与脱硫系统的关键设备,其正常投用不仅是脱硫系统能否正常投运的关键,更关系到脱硫系统本身甚至发电机组的安全。通过对旁路挡板联锁保护逻辑的分析.提出了实施旁路挡板铅封措施后旁路挡板的联锁保护措施的更改建议,使更改后的联锁保护逻辑更为完善。

关 键 词:湿法脱硫  旁路挡板  联锁保护

ANALYSIS ON IMPROVEMENT OF INTERLOCK PROTECTION LOGIC OF LEAD SEALED BYPASS DAMPER

Abstract:According to the requirements of Ministry of Environmental Protection, thermal power enterprises need to ensure their bypass dampers lead sealed. Because of the advantages of excellent desulphurization performance and mature technology, wet flue gas desulphurization system now is widely used in coal-fired generating units. The healthy running of bypass damper, which is the key equipment in connection between generating unit and desulphurization system, relates to the safety of desulphurization system and even generating unit. The improvement advices of lead sealed bypass dampers interlock logics are proposed via the analy sis of interlock logics. All these should bring about more improvements for the interlock logic.
Keywords:wet flue gas desulphurization  bypass damper  interlock protection
